What does Joseph suspect about Snake?

ASnake is planning to leave without Joseph's permission

BSnake has stolen something valuable from Joseph's house

CSnake is in conversation with Rowley and may reveal their secret plot

DSnake is plotting to steal Maria's affection away from Joseph

Answer:

C. Snake is in conversation with Rowley and may reveal their secret plot

Read Explanation:

  • Joseph Surface suspects Snake because he learns that Snake has been in conversation with Rowley, Sir Oliver’s former steward.

  • Snake is a key accomplice in the plot between Joseph and Lady Sneerwell to spread rumors about Charles and Lady Teazle.

  • Joseph worries that Snake might betray their secret plan by revealing it to Rowley or others.

  • This suspicion highlights Joseph's lack of trust, even towards his collaborators, which aligns with his duplicitous and self-serving nature.

  • The fear that Snake might expose their schemes adds tension to the storyline, as the success of their plot depends on secrecy.
